On Wednesday, January 11th, Jasper Police Department was dispatched to Knoll Ridge Apartments at 448 W. 43rd St., Apartment 43 in Jasper for a possible fight in progress. The caller advised there was loud yelling and screaming inside the apartment. Upon the officer’s arrival, it was determined that there was no fight at said apartment.

However, after identifying everyone inside the apartment, it was determined that a man in apartment was Terry Zink. Zink had a felony failure to appear warrant for drug related offenses in 2015. Zink was transported to the Dubois County Security Center for said warrant.
